Acer’s back-to-school 2025 lineup lands in UAE: AI-powered Aspire series and gaming beasts

Just in time for the new school year, Acer has refreshed its UAE laptop lineup with devices designed for students balancing study, creativity, and gaming. The range spans affordable AI-enabled Aspire models to high-performance Predator rigs, all shipping with Windows 11 and a dedicated Copilot key for quick access to Microsoft’s AI assistant.

Aspire Lite – Everyday Workhorse

At AED 2,499, the Aspire Lite targets students who need a reliable machine without breaking the bank. It comes with a 13th Gen Intel Core i7, 16GB DDR5 RAM, and a roomy 1TB SSD. The 15.6-inch Full HD display is paired with a battery promising up to 10 hours of use — enough to cover classes and evening streaming.

Aspire 14 AI – Smarter Productivity

Those looking to dive into AI-enhanced workflows may lean toward the Aspire 14 AI (AED 3,399). Powered by an Intel Core Ultra 7 with an AI Boost NPU, it boasts 47 TOPS of AI performance — allowing it to handle offline and online AI tasks like note summarization, voice transcription, and image generation. The 14-inch 1920×1200 touchscreen, slim profile, and 25-hour battery life make it ideal for students bouncing between lectures and coffee shops.

Nitro V 15 – Student Gaming Rig

For students who split time between classwork and esports, Acer’s Nitro V 15 (AED 4,999) offers solid specs: a 13th Gen Intel Core i9, NVIDIA GeForce RTX 5060, and 165Hz Full HD IPS panel. With DLSS 4 AI-enhanced graphics, it’s tuned for smooth gameplay, while 16GB DDR4 RAM and 1TB storage keep it future-proof for both gaming and video-editing needs.

Predator Helios Neo 16 – Top-Tier Power

The flagship of this year’s lineup, the Predator Helios Neo 16 (AED 8,999), is aimed at creators and competitive gamers. Running on an Intel Core Ultra 9 with AI Boost alongside an RTX 5070 GPU, it’s fitted with 32GB DDR5 RAM, 1TB SSD, and a 16-inch QHD+ display with a 240Hz refresh rate. Designed for demanding tasks like 3D rendering, streaming, and AAA gaming, it also includes Killer Wi-Fi 6E, 5Gbps Ethernet, and Acer’s Predator Sense control software for tuning performance.

Pricing and Availability

Acer’s back-to-school lineup will be available across UAE retailers starting September:

  • Aspire Lite – AED 2,499
  • Aspire 14 AI – AED 3,399
  • Nitro V 15 – AED 4,999
  • Predator Helios Neo 16 – AED 8,999

Exact configurations and availability may vary by market.
